Output 170f8247661cc014d223e236eb87ea0d5d4e03358ff145433db6dde301ce8280:0

value
1253596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b3c3cc25e76b9120eb6cb5ccbe37ead5665a7d OP_EQUAL
address
358NGvNqZRWLoZU1wj4GyDfGaWmBVApGEC
transaction
170f8247661cc014d223e236eb87ea0d5d4e03358ff145433db6dde301ce8280
spent
true